What's The Definition Of Cenotaphy?Synonyms | Synonyms for Cenotaphy: Related Terms | Find terms related to Cenotaphy: See Also | Cenotaphy In Webster's Dictionary \Cen"o*taph`y\, n.
A cenotaph. [R.]
Lord Cobham honored him with a cenotaphy. --Macaulay.
